Group 1A (also known as Group 1 or the alkali metals) consists of the following elements in increasing atomic number:

1. Hydrogen (H) - atomic number 1

2. Lithium (Li) - atomic number 3

3. Sodium (Na) - atomic number 11

4. Potassium (K) - atomic number 19

5. Rubidium (Rb) - atomic number 37

6. Cesium (Cs) - atomic number 55

7. Francium (Fr) - atomic number 87

Group 11A (also known as Group 11 or the coinage metals) consists of the following elements in increasing atomic number:

1. Copper (Cu) - atomic number 29

2. Silver (Ag) - atomic number 47

3. Gold (Au) - atomic number 79

Period 3 consists of the following elements in increasing atomic number:

1. Sodium (Na) - atomic number 11 (also present in Group 1A)

2. Magnesium (Mg) - atomic number 12

3. Aluminum (Al) - atomic number 13

4. Silicon (Si) - atomic number 14

5. Phosphorus (P) - atomic number 15

6. Sulfur (S) - atomic number 16

7. Chlorine (Cl) - atomic number 17

8. Argon (Ar) - atomic number 18
